"Counting the People provides a comprehensive survey of the Irish censuses from 1813 to 1911. Several eminent Victorian polymaths, such as Thomas Larcom, William Wilde (father of Oscar) and Thomas W. Grimshaw, were involved in the design and organization of successive census-taking exercises, and their labours produced works of great value to economic and social historians. The censuses of 1851 and 1861, in particular, are unsurpassed in the breadth of their scholarship."--Jacket.
